Choosing The Right E-bike Lock

Choosing the right e-bike lock is key to keeping your bike safe. A good lock stops thieves and gives you peace of mind. Different locks fit different needs. Understanding lock types, materials, and security ratings helps you pick the best option.

Types Of E-bike Locks

U-locks are strong and hard to cut. They fit around the bike frame and a fixed object. Chain locks offer flexibility and strength. They can wrap around larger objects. Cable locks are light and easy to carry. They work for low-risk areas but are less secure.

Lock Materials And Durability

Steel is the most common and tough material for locks. Hardened steel resists cutting and sawing. Some locks use alloys to reduce weight without losing strength. Avoid cheap metals that break easily. Weather resistance matters too. Rust can weaken your lock over time.

Security Ratings To Consider

Check for security ratings from trusted organizations. Ratings show how well a lock stands up to attacks. Higher ratings mean better protection but often higher cost. Find a balance between price and security. Think about where you park your e-bike most often.

Top E-bike Locks On The Market

Choosing the right lock protects your e-bike from theft. Different locks offer various levels of security and convenience. The best lock depends on your needs and where you park your bike. Below are the top types of e-bike locks on the market.

U-locks And D-locks

U-locks are strong and hard to break. They are shaped like a “U” or a “D.” These locks work well for securing your bike frame to a solid object. They are compact and easy to carry. U-locks resist cutting and leverage attacks. They are a reliable choice for high-risk areas.

Chain Locks

Chain locks use thick metal links to guard your bike. They offer flexibility in locking to different objects. Chains with hardened steel links are hard to cut. These locks can be heavy but provide strong protection. Use a quality padlock with the chain for best security.

Folding Locks

Folding locks fold into a small shape for easy storage. They combine flexibility and strength. The links are made of metal plates connected by rivets. Folding locks are lighter than chains but still secure. They fit well in bike bags or mounted holders.

Cable Locks

Cable locks are lightweight and easy to carry. They use braided steel cables covered with plastic. These locks are flexible and good for low-risk areas or short stops. Cable locks are less secure than other types. Use them with another lock for extra safety.

Locking Techniques For Maximum Security

Keeping your e-bike safe requires smart locking techniques. A strong lock alone is not enough. How you lock your bike matters a lot. Follow clear steps to stop thieves and protect your ride.

Securing The Frame And Wheels

Always lock the frame of your e-bike. The frame is the main part and hard to remove. Use a sturdy lock to hold it tight. Don’t forget the wheels. They can be easy to steal. Lock the wheels to a fixed object or use extra locks for each wheel. This stops quick wheel thefts.

Choosing The Best Locking Location

Pick a busy and well-lit spot to park your bike. Thieves avoid places where many people pass by. Look for solid objects like metal poles or bike racks. Avoid thin or weak objects. They can be cut or broken fast. The stronger and thicker the object, the safer your bike stays.

Using Multiple Locks Effectively

Use two or more locks for better safety. A strong U-lock plus a cable lock works well. Lock the frame with the U-lock. Use the cable lock on the wheels. Different locks slow down thieves. They need more tools and time to steal your bike. This extra effort often stops theft.

Additional Security Tips

Securing your e-bike goes beyond just using the best lock. Small actions can protect your bike even more. These extra steps lower the risk of theft and give you peace of mind. Here are practical tips to keep your e-bike safe.

Removing Or Securing Accessories

Take off accessories like lights and bags when parking. Thieves target loose items first. Store them in a safe place or lock them separately. This reduces the chance of losing valuable parts.

Parking In Safe And Visible Areas

Choose well-lit and busy spots to park your e-bike. Thieves avoid places where people watch closely. Avoid hidden or dark corners. This simple habit makes your bike less attractive to thieves.

Registering Your E-bike

Register your e-bike with local or online databases. This helps police find your bike if stolen. Registration also proves ownership in disputes. Keep your registration details in a safe place.

Smart Lock Technology

Smart lock technology brings a new level of security to e-bike locks. It uses digital features to protect your bike better than traditional locks. These locks often connect with your phone, making it easy to control and monitor your bike’s safety.

Smart locks combine convenience with modern technology. They help reduce the risk of theft by using advanced features. Users can manage their locks remotely and get alerts if something is wrong.

Bluetooth And App-enabled Locks

Bluetooth locks connect directly to your smartphone. You use an app to lock or unlock your bike. Some apps allow sharing access with friends or family. This feature is useful when lending your bike.

The app can show lock status in real time. It sends notifications if someone tries to tamper with the lock. Bluetooth locks are easy to use and quick to operate.

Gps Tracking Features

Many smart locks include GPS tracking. This feature helps you find your bike if it gets stolen. The GPS sends your bike’s location to your phone. You can track your bike’s movement at all times.

GPS tracking adds extra security by letting you act fast. It also helps police recover stolen bikes more easily. This feature is important for valuable e-bikes.

Pros And Cons Of Smart Locks

Smart locks offer strong security and ease of use. They provide remote control and instant alerts. GPS tracking adds an extra layer of protection.

Some smart locks depend on battery power. If the battery dies, the lock might not work properly. Bluetooth signals can be blocked by obstacles. GPS tracking may use more battery and data.

Smart locks tend to cost more than traditional locks. They require basic knowledge of apps and smartphones. Still, many riders find the benefits worth the cost and effort.

Maintaining Your E-bike Lock

Maintaining your e-bike lock ensures it stays strong and reliable. A well-kept lock protects your e-bike from theft. Simple care steps extend the life of your lock and keep it working smoothly.

Preventing Rust And Wear

Rust weakens your lock and makes it hard to open. Wipe your lock dry after rain or snow. Use a cloth to remove dirt and moisture. Apply a small amount of lubricant to the keyhole. This prevents rust and keeps the lock turning easily.

Regular Lock Inspection

Check your lock often for damage or signs of wear. Look for cracks, bent parts, or stuck mechanisms. Test the key or combination to ensure smooth operation. Early detection helps avoid lock failure and costly repairs.

Proper Storage Practices

Store your lock in a dry place when not in use. Avoid leaving it exposed to harsh weather for long periods. Use a protective cover or bag to shield it from dirt and moisture. Proper storage keeps the lock in top condition and ready to protect your e-bike.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Is The Best Type Of Lock For E-bikes?

U-locks and heavy-duty chain locks are best for e-bikes. They offer strong protection against theft. Choose locks with high-grade steel and anti-pick features for maximum security.

How Do I Choose A Secure E-bike Lock?

Look for locks with high security ratings and durable materials. Consider lock size, weight, and ease of use. Always pick a lock that suits your bike’s value and typical parking spots.

Can E-bike Locks Prevent All Types Of Theft?

No lock guarantees 100% theft prevention, but quality locks deter most thieves. Combining a strong lock with secure parking reduces theft risk significantly.

Are Cable Locks Safe For E-bikes?

Cable locks are lightweight but less secure. They can be cut easily. Use them only as secondary locks alongside a sturdy U-lock or chain lock.
